Abstract

The utility model discloses a conveyer belt type automatic vacuum liquid filling machine, comprising a support stander, a battery transporting device, a manipulator, a vacuumizing device and a bracket which are arranged on the support stander, and a driving device arranged on the bracket. The driving device is connected with a vacuum sealing and connecting device that is connected with a liquid filling device, a vacuum tube connection port is arranged on the vacuum sealing and connecting device which is connected and communicated with the vacuumizing device. The automatic liquid filling machine seals a cylindrical battery port by the vacuum sealing and connecting device, meanwhile, the vacuumizing device is filled with the electric liquid, therefore, the utility model has high working efficiency and automatic efficiency. The electric liquid quantity filled in the battery is high in precision and easy in control and the batch of battery can be filled only by one person.

Background technology
The domestic production column type lithium cell all is to adopt artificial a small amount of injection one by one when adding electric liquid in battery at present, vacuumizes with the vacuum ware, and repeated multiple times just can be finished.Inefficiency like this, the injection volume of electric liquid is inaccurate, influences the quality of battery like this, and the amount of labour used is big.

Embodiment
It is the conveyer belt type automatic vacuum fluid injection machine that double end is injected electric liquid simultaneously.Can certainly adopt single head or bull structure.As shown in Figure 1, be furnished with three battery conveying devices on the platen 8 of frames 7, be shown as conveyer belt 50,51,52 among the figure.Between three conveyer belts, shift to install manipulator 25 on the platen 8.Manipulator 25 comprises the vertical cylinder 4 that is located on the platen 8, vertically establishes lateral cylinder 3 on the cylinder 4, establishes two gas folders 201,202 on the lateral cylinder 3.Motor 1 is located at the end of frames 9.Correspondingly on the platen 8 establish two supports 9.
As shown in Figure 2, establish drive unit 13 on each support 9, drive unit 13 is a cylinder, and the piston rod 131 of cylinder 13 connects the vacuum seal jockey.The vacuum seal jockey comprises the adapter sleeve 14 that is connected with cylinder 13, establishes liquid injection hole 27 in the adapter sleeve 14, and liquid injection hole 27 communicates with vacuum tube connector 15, and liquid injection hole 27 constitutes " T " three-way shape with vacuum tube connector 15.Hypomere in " T " threeway is established the battery port sealing device.The battery port sealing device comprises the spacer 17 that is located in the liquid injection hole 27, and sealing ring 28,29 is established on respectively in spacer 17 upper surfaces and lower surface.27 times inner segments of liquid injection hole connect battery enclosure mouth 20, shown in the figure are to connect by screw thread 21.Establish sealing device 18 between spacer 17 and the battery enclosure mouth 20, it can be sealing ring or sealed picture for a sealing device 18.Battery enclosure mouth 20 epimere socket septulums cover 19.Priming device comprises the pipeline 10 that is communicated with liquid injection hole 27, establishes control valve 11 on the pipeline 10, and the other end of pipeline 10 connects fluid injection cup 12.Fluid injection cup 12 is located on the support 9.Vacuum tube connector 15 can connect (not shown) with vacuum extractor.
This machine course of work is: at first vertically cylinder 4 advances, gas folder 201 batteries of clamping on the conveyer belt 52 6, and gas folder 202 is opened; Lateral cylinder 3 moves and battery 6 is put into battery enclosure mouth 20 times opens, and adapter sleeve 14 falls, and battery enclosure mouth 20 covers battery port, and sealing device 18 is with the battery port sealing, and control valve 11 sucks the electric liquid in the fluid injection cup 12 in the battery when vacuumizing; Vertically cylinder 4 backhauls after finishing, lateral cylinder 3 are moved gas folder 202 battery are clamped vertical cylinder 4 propellings, and the battery of filling with electric liquid is delivered on the conveyer belt 51, finish a circulation.
